Posted onUS equities trudged to the starting line and fell into the finish line, clearly still recovering from the long Labor Day weekend. The NASDAQ attempted recovery midday, but ultimately succumbed to losses by the close. It was the Russell 2000 that saw the largest losses of the day, down 1.9%, led lower by Trinseo (-20.0%) and Aaron’s Co.
